Temperature and Seasonal Timing for Optimal Growth
Temperature is the single most critical factor in pansy growing conditions, defining their role as a cool-season champion. Unlike warm-season annuals, pansies perform best when temperatures hover between 40°F and 60°F, actively growing during the cool springs and autumns. They are engineered by nature to survive light frosts, and in fact, a touch of cold often intensifies their vibrant color palette. Planting too late in the spring is a common mistake; once temperatures consistently rise above 75°F, growth becomes leggy, flowers fade quickly, and the plant struggles to survive the heat.
Soil Composition and Drainage Requirements
Well-draining, organically rich soil is non-negotiable for healthy pansies. They demand a soil structure that retains moisture without becoming waterlogged, as soggy roots are a primary cause of failure. Amend your garden bed with generous amounts of compost or well-rotted manure to improve both fertility and drainage. The ideal pH level is slightly acidic to neutral, ranging from 6.0 to 6.5, which optimizes nutrient availability. If your soil is heavy clay, consider growing pansies in raised beds or containers filled with a premium potting mix to ensure their roots remain aerated.
Sunlight Exposure and Light Management
Balancing Sun and Shade
Providing the right balance of sun and shade is essential for robust pansy growing conditions. Aim for a location that receives a minimum of six hours of direct sunlight daily; this exposure encourages sturdy stems and abundant blooms. In regions with intensely hot summers, however, a little afternoon shade can be beneficial, protecting the flowers from scorching and prolonging their display. Too little light results in sparse foliage and few flowers, while too much intense heat without moisture causes the plants to shut down and cease production.
Watering Practices and Moisture Control
Consistent moisture is a cornerstone of successful pansy culture, but it must be applied wisely. The goal is to keep the soil evenly moist but never saturated, as wet feet lead to root rot. Water deeply at the base of the plant early in the morning, allowing the foliage to dry off during the day. This practice reduces the risk of fungal diseases. Mulching around the plants helps to retain soil moisture, regulate temperature, and suppress weeds that compete for water and nutrients.
Fertilization and Nutrient Management
While pansies are not heavy feeders, a strategic application of nutrients significantly enhances their vigor and flowering capacity. A balanced, water-soluble fertilizer applied every four to six weeks provides the necessary support for continuous growth. Look for formulations with equal N-P-K ratios, or those slightly higher in phosphorus to encourage bloom development. Avoid over-fertilizing with high-nitrogen formulas, as this promotes excessive leaf growth at the expense of the flowers you want to see.
Ongoing Maintenance and Deadheading
Regular maintenance is the key to extending the lifespan of your pansies throughout the season. The simple act of deadheading—removing spent blooms—prevents the plant from setting seed and redirects its energy into producing new flowers. In late fall, a light application of fertilizer can help fortify the plants for winter. If you are growing them as biennials in mild climates, protect them from extreme cold with a layer of mulch to ensure they survive to bloom again the following spring.
